West’s father-daughter time with North comes as he and his ex-wife feud over their four children.
Last week, the Grammy winner, 47, launched a tune titled “Lonely Roads Still Go to Sunshine,” which featured Sean “Diddy” Combs, his son Christian “King” Combs, Chicago artist Jasmine Williams and North.
The Skims co-founder, 44, tried to get a judge to stop the song from being released as a result of she didn’t need her daughter tied to the Bad Boy Records founder’s legal woes, which embody charges of sex trafficking.
A supply instructed Page Six, “Kim’s priority is the well-being and safety of her children and to protect them from being around Kanye’s controversial behavior.”
Despite Kardashian’s considerations, West dropped the track anyway on social media and demanded she amend her trademark of North’s identify to incorporate him.
The “All of the Lights” rapper accused his ex and the “Kardashian mob” of restricting his parenting.
